(And Why DOTs Care So Much) A Truck-Mounted Attenuator (TMA) is a crash cushion mounted on the back of a truck. When a vehicle strikes it, the attenuator absorbs impact energy, protecting both workers in the work zone and the occupants of the striking vehicle. Think of it as a mobile barrier that sacrifices itself to save lives. Why are state DOT work zone safety regulations so strict about these trucks? The statistics are brutal. According to FHWA data, over 100 workers die in work zone crashes every year, with hundreds more seriously injured. TMAs have proven to reduce fatality rates by up to 70% in mobile operations. MASH vs NCHRP 350: What Changed and Why It Matters Here’s where many contractors get tripped up. The old standard was NCHRP 350 (National Cooperative Highway Research Program Report 350). It was replaced by MASH (Manual for Assessing Safety Hardware) starting in 2011, with a transition period that technically ended years ago. But here’s the reality: some older equipment still bears NCHRP 350 certification, and contractors ask me regularly whether it’s still acceptable. Short answer: It depends on the state, but most now require full MASH compliance. MASH TMA certification requirements are more stringent than the old standard. The crash testing is more realistic—higher impact speeds, different vehicle types, and more demanding angles. MASH Test Level 3 (TL-3) is the standard for most highway applications, requiring the attenuator to handle: Pickup trucks at 62 mph Small cars at 62 mph Various impact angles up to 25 degrees The equipment either passes these tests or it doesn’t. There’s no gray area when it comes to compliance with attenuator truck standards. Federal Baseline: What FHWA Requires Nationwide Before we dive into state-specific TMA truck requirements, let’s establish the federal baseline that applies everywhere. The Federal Highway Administration requires that all work zone traffic control devices used on federal-aid highways meet MASH standards. This is based on the MUTCD (Manual on Uniform Traffic Control Devices) and associated federal regulations. At a minimum, your TMA truck must: Have MASH TL-3 certification (the actual attenuator unit) Display proper warning lights and markings It should be operated according to the manufacturer’s specifications Have documentation available on-site Undergo regular inspections and maintenance The host truck also matters. You can’t just bolt a MASH-certified attenuator onto any old truck and call it compliant. The vehicle must meet the attenuator manufacturer’s specifications for: Gross Vehicle Weight Rating (GVWR) Wheelbase length Frame strength Ballast requirements State-by-State TMA Requirements: The Details That Matter Now let’s get into the specifics. Northeast Region New York: The NYSDOT requires MASH TL-3 certification and strictly enforces host-vehicle specifications. All TMAs on state projects must be on the approved products list (APL). Night work requires additional lighting beyond federal minimums. Expect inspections—NYSDOT doesn’t mess around. New Jersey: New Jersey DOT follows MUTCD requirements and requires MASH certification. The state also mandates specific arrow board configurations that must be used with your TMA. Pennsylvania: PennDOT has one of the more comprehensive TMA programs in the Northeast. They require MASH TL-3 and mandate specific operator training. You can’t just hand the keys to any worker—operators need documented training on deployment procedures and emergency protocols. PennDOT also requires annual inspections with documentation submitted to the district office. Massachusetts: MassDOT closely follows federal guidelines but adds requirements for high-visibility striping beyond the MUTCD minimums. They’re also strict about arrow board synchronization with the TMA unit. Mid-Atlantic Region Virginia: VDOT requires MASH certification and has specific guidelines for rural vs. urban deployments. They also mandate GPS tracking on TMA trucks for certain projects, which helps with compliance documentation but requires additional equipment. Southeast Region Florida: FDOT has extensive TMA requirements, especially for interstate work. They require MASH TL-3 certification, maintain a qualified products list, and mandate specific operator training. Florida also has detailed requirements for hurricane-season operations—TMAs must be secured or removed during specified weather events. Georgia: GDOT adheres to MASH standards and requires semiannual inspections. They’re strict about maintenance documentation and will disqualify equipment that shows excessive wear. North Carolina: NCDOT requires MASH TL-3 and maintains an approved products list. They’ve been aggressive about phasing out older NCHRP 350 equipment—if it’s not MASH certified, don’t bring it to an NCDOT project. Texas and the South Central Texas: TxDOT has some of the most detailed temporary traffic control requirements in the country. They require MASH TL-3 certification, maintain a strict approved products list, and mandate specific operator training. Texas also requires detailed traffic control plans (TCPs) that specify TMA placement for different scenarios. Here’s something many contractors miss: TxDOT has specific requirements for shadow vehicles (the truck carrying the TMA) regarding weight, braking systems, and even tire specifications. Read the special provisions carefully—Texas projects often have district-specific requirements beyond the statewide standards.
